2015-10-27 A smooth pursuit eye movement is induced when we look at a moving object to stabilize the image on or near the fovea. Pursuit initiation is supported by visuomotor systems where visual motion signals are transformed into pursuit commands (Krauzlis 2004 ; Lisberger 2010 ).

The examination of smooth pursuit performance quantifies a subject's ability to follow a moving object as precisely as possible with the eyes, requiring an exact matching of eye velocity to target velocity during ongoing pursuit. 1 Specific deficits of smooth pursuit eye movements represent a widely replicated intermediate phenotype for schizophrenia‐spectrum and psychotic affective

Smooth pursuit eye movements are used to maintain stable gaze on objects that are moving within the visual field. Focus is placed on the object of interest while the background is ‘‘blurred.’’ For example, if you hold your head still and watch a cr drive by, you are using smooth pursuit eye movements to keep the car in the center of your line of vision.

A smooth pursuit is a controlled and guided movement of both eyes on a moving target. If you put one finger in front of you and watch it as you slowly move it around, then you are making a smooth pursuit. Function Smooth pursuits are important for following moving targets. They are necessary for such activities as sports and driving. Deficiency of Smooth Pursuit
